The Role
As CFO, you will serve as a strategic partner to the CEO and executive leadership team, overseeing the company's financial organization and helping shape its next stage of growth.
You will own financial strategy, forecasting, budgeting, cash management, financial reporting, capital planning, risk management, and performance analysis. The ideal candidate combines strong technical finance expertise with commercial judgment and the ability to translate complex financial information into clear business decisions.
This is a hands-on executive role suited to a finance leader who is comfortable operating in a fast-moving, technology-driven environment and building scalable financial processes as the organization grows.
What You Will Do
Lead Nexorynt's overall financial strategy, planning, and long-term financial direction.
Partner with the CEO and executive team on strategic planning, investments, growth initiatives, and resource allocation.
Own the annual budgeting and forecasting process, including rolling forecasts and long-range financial planning.
Establish financial models, dashboards, and KPIs that provide leadership with clear visibility into company performance.
Oversee cash flow management, working capital, liquidity planning, and capital allocation.
Lead monthly, quarterly, and annual financial reporting and ensure accurate and timely management reporting.
Develop financial analysis supporting pricing, profitability, expansion, hiring, product investments, and other strategic decisions.
Build scalable finance processes, controls, policies, and reporting infrastructure as the company grows.
Oversee accounting operations, including the month-end close, reconciliations, financial statements, and coordination with external accounting partners.
Manage relationships with banks, investors, auditors, tax advisors, legal counsel, and other financial stakeholders.
Develop and maintain appropriate internal controls and financial governance practices.
Identify financial risks and opportunities and provide practical recommendations to executive leadership.
Lead fundraising, debt financing, M&A, or other capital-related initiatives when applicable.
Monitor business performance against financial targets and investigate significant variances.
Evaluate unit economics, margins, customer economics, operating expenses, and return on investment.
Establish financial systems and technology that improve automation, reporting accuracy, and operational efficiency.
Support executive leadership and the board with financial presentations, forecasts, strategic analysis, and business updates.
Build, mentor, and lead a high-performing finance and accounting organization as the company scales.
